Batching jar with can dismantle agitating unit
Technical Field
The utility model relates to a batching jar technical field, concretely relates to batching jar with can dismantle agitating unit.
Background
The mixing system of the dispensing tank is generally intended to provide a relatively uniform mixing and blending or mutual dissolution of the various materials already placed in the dispensing tank to meet the standards of use.
The general stirring device is that the motor drive shaft drives 2 stirring leaves that are distributed in parallel from top to bottom, utilizes two stirring leaves of top and bottom to stir the material when stirring.
Generally have agitating unit's batching jar, its agitating unit all is undetachable or inconvenient dismantlement, and this has produced great limitation to the working range and the controllability of batching jar, the utility model discloses the batching jar that has detachable agitating unit who introduces not only improves the detachable construction that increases on agitating unit's original basis, has still increased the simple temperature control system that can heat up or cool down.

as shown in attached figures 1-2, the utility model discloses a batching tank with a detachable stirring device, which comprises a tank body 1, a stirring component, a base 2, a speed reducer 3, a fixing part 4 and a power source 5, wherein a batching cavity 6 is formed in the tank body 1, the tank body 1 is provided with a base 7, the base 2 is connected with the base 7 through the fixing part 4, the stirring component is arranged in the batching cavity 6 and comprises a transmission rod, stirring blades 10 and a blade connecting seat 11, the transmission rod is divided into a first transmission rod 8 and a second transmission rod 9, the first transmission rod 8 and the second transmission rod 9 are respectively provided with a matching panel 12 at one end, the matching panels 12 of the first transmission rod 8 and the second transmission rod 9 are matched and then connected and fixed through the fixing part 4, the stirring blades 10 are connected with the blade connecting seat 11, the blade connecting seat 11 is provided with an assembling port 13, the one end that the second transfer line 9 does not have cooperation panel 12 is connected the assembly mouth 13, makes flabellum connecting seat 11 and second transfer line 9 be connected and fixed, speed reducer 3 passes mounting 4 and connects frame 2, frame 2 has the connecting hole, first transfer line 8 passes the connecting hole and connects speed reducer 3, power supply 5 connects speed reducer 3, the utility model discloses add a can dismantle and can control fast agitating unit on the basis of batching jar, agitating unit's subassembly mainly comprises transfer line, stirring vane 10 and flabellum connecting seat 11, in order to can dismantle and dismantle the simple process, just divide into two parts with the transfer line, one part is called first transfer line 8 that connects frame 2 and speed reducer 3, and second transfer line 9 is the part of connecting flabellum connecting seat 11, has all set up cooperation panel 12 in the position that both connect, the first transmission rod 8 is provided with a convex character matching panel 12, the second transmission rod 9 is provided with a concave character matching panel 12, the two panels are matched through shapes, the fixing piece 4 is used for fixing the two panels, the fixing piece 4 is composed of a screw and a nut, if the base 2, the speed reducer 3 and the power source 5 are connected and fixed through the fixing piece 4, the first transmission rod 8 and the second transmission rod 9 are connected with each other through the matching mode, the matching between the two rods can be stabilized through a simple matching structure, and the disassembly is convenient.
The tank body 1 is also provided with a jacket 14, a temperature control inlet 15 and a temperature control outlet 16, the jacket 14 wraps part of the surface of the tank body 1, a temperature control cavity 17 is formed between the jacket 14 and the tank body 1, the temperature control inlet 15 is arranged on the side surface of the jacket 14 and is close to the top end of the jacket 14, the temperature control outlet 16 is arranged at the bottom of the jacket 14, the temperature control inlet 15 and the temperature control outlet 16 are both communicated with the temperature control cavity 17, the jacket 14 has a heat preservation function, a heat preservation or cooling material can be filled into the temperature control inlet 15 to control the temperature of the material in the tank, and the material is drawn out through the temperature control outlet when the temperature control material.
The machine base 2 is also provided with a cavity 18 and a fixing clamp 19, the fixing clamp 19 is arranged in the cavity 18, and after the first transmission rod 8 penetrates through the machine base 2, part of the rod body surface in the cavity 18 is in contact with the clamping surface of the fixing clamp 19.
The jar body 1 still has discharge gate 20 and inlet 21, discharge gate 20 sets up in jar 1 bottom of the body, inlet 21 sets up at jar 1 top of the body, discharge gate 20 and inlet 21 all with batching chamber 6 communicates with each other.
The power source 5 is inverter motor, the power source 5 has transmission shaft 22, the speed reducer 3 has through-hole and speed reducer 23, the transmission shaft 22 stretches into the through-hole and connects speed reducer 23, can carry out accurate the accuse to agitating unit's rotational speed under inverter motor closes the cooperation of speed reducer 3.
Discharge gate 20 has set up ooff valve 24, ooff valve 24 sets up and connects discharge gate 20 in jar body 1 bottom, and the effect of setting up ooff valve 24 is that the flow of feed liquid is more stable when making the ejection of compact for the cooperation structure between ooff valve 24 and the discharge gate 20.
